The Foolproof ?5 Concealer That Sells Out Every 60 Seconds

Concealers are a necessary step in any foolproof beauty routine. I used to leave mine out, but as I get older, I notice I need extra help, particularly?when it comes to covering blemishes.? To create a perfect base, one should be used ideally before you apply your?foundation of choice and one that is a shade later than your fluid.

Whether you want to banish under-eye bags, cover that annoying blemish or?correct any other imperfections, there is a range of options on the market to suit any budget, but I always go back to the same one:?Collection 2000’s Lasting Perfection Concealer, for only €4.79. And just this week, the budget beauty brand has revealed that 10 of its?Lasting Perfection Concealers?are sold every 60 seconds. Makeup artist and general beauty guru Lisa Eldridge is even a fan.

This under-rated gem can?be found in a Boots near you. As it costs less than €5, you would be blamed for having doubts about its lasting effects, but this one ticks many boxes. Available in four colours (Fair, Light, Medium and Deep) it is transfer-proof and is a highlighting and concealing manna from heaven. The creamy formulation is both easily blendable and buildable so you’ll be waving adieu to those dark circles in no time. Basically, all you could want from a concealer.
